Groveland Fire Department and A.W. Chesterton Company to Participate in Groveland Day

GROVELAND –  Fire Chief Robert Lay and Andrew Chesterton, CEO and President of A.W. Chesterton Company, are pleased to announce that several activities are planned for Groveland Day this weekend.

The annual event, which occurs on Sept. 17, invites residents out of their homes and into the community to celebrate the town. To begin the day, Chesterton will host the 5th Annual Chesterton 5k Walk/Run and Kids 1 Mile Fun Run

The 1 Mile Fun Run will begin at 8 a.m. and the 5K will start at 8:30 a.m., both at the Chesterton headquarters, 860 Salem St. Participants in the the 5k Walk/Run, will start and finish at the Chesterton facility. The Kids 1 Mile Fun Run will be two laps around the Chesterton property. Awards will be given to the top three finishers in each age group.

“As in years past, we’re excited to host this race for avid runners, beginners and children who want to challenge themselves with the mile fun run,” Chesterton said. “Saturday is looking like it will be a beautiful day and we’re anticipating a great turnout for the race.”

After the race, beginning at 10 a.m., a celebration will be held at the Pines Recreation Area (222 Main St.)

The Groveland Fire Department will have several activities planned for families. A junior firefighting challenge will give children the opportunity to go through a miniature obstacle course that features different aspects of the fire industry – from crawling through tunnels (like when firefighters crawl through a burning building), carrying a hose and shooting at a target with the hose.

Gear from the Haverhill Firefighting Museum will be available for children to try on and Groveland firefighters will demonstrate how to do so using their own suits and equipment.

Residents are also invited to visit the fire education booth, where handouts on Fire Prevention Week (Oct 9-15) and general fire education topics will be available. Firefighters will also perform CPR demonstrations.

“This has always been a fun event for the Groveland Fire Department that really allows the community to interact with firefighters, while learning about fire safety, in an enjoyable setting,” Chief Lay said. “We have a lot of great activities planned, especially for our youth, and we hope to see residents out enjoying Groveland Day.”

The West Newbury Fire Department’s Ladder truck will also be on site to assist Groveland’s Cub Scout Pack 113 with their egg drop project at 1 p.m.

To end the day, a BBQ and band will play at night at the Pines for all to enjoy.
